About The Position

Working collaboratively with the maintenance team, the Certified Electrician is responsible for executing maintenance programs and electrical projects to ensure the reliable operation of all electrical systems within the mill environment. This role requires strong communication, problem-solving, and computer skills.

Responsibilities

  • Perform general electrical maintenance across mill operations.
  • Install, maintain, and repair electrical systems, controls, and wiring on all mill equipment.
  • Diagnose and troubleshoot electrical, pneumatic, hydraulic, and mechanical systems.
  • Perform corrective maintenance on circuit breakers and related components.
  • Replace and repair faulty electrical components including motors, relays, switches, and gearboxes.
  • Read and interpret technical diagrams, schematics, and blueprints.
  • Work with live voltage (up to 480 VAC) for troubleshooting purposes.
  • Develop and implement maintenance plans in collaboration with the maintenance team.
  • Utilize diagnostic and monitoring equipment to identify issues and opportunities for improvement.
  • Support initiatives that improve efficiency, reliability, and cost savings.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ement and innovation efforts aligned with company goals.
  • Follow all safety rules, regulations, and company policies.
  • Identify and eliminate potential hazards in the work environment.
  • Apply safe maintenance practices, including proper scheduling and lockout/tagout procedures.
  • Maintain working knowledge of all mill equipment and systems.
  • Troubleshoot and repair equipment issues in a timely and efficient manner.
  • Work effectively in physically demanding environments, including: Extreme temperatures (hot/cold) Elevated areas (ladders, platforms) Confined, dirty, or oily spaces Heavy lifting, bending, and reaching
